  • At present the identification of vessels is still depending on the OOW (Officer Of Wateh) in VTS (Vessel Traffic Service), which is completed by radar, and also by the combination of VHF radio and VHF direction finder. However, with the development of port transportation and economic, this conventional way of identification can't satisfy more and more request for the information that the VTS needs from the vessels. In such a case, the AIS(Automatic Identification System) precept which is based on STDMA (Self-organized Time Division Multiple Access) technique is put forward by IMO (International Maritime Organization). AIS can automatically provide the information, including own ship's identification, type, position, course, speed, and other information to the appropriately equipped coast station and other ships. At the same time it can also automatically monitor and track the nearby ships similarly fitted with AIS. On the basis of describing the whole comprising and the format of transmission information of AIS, this paper mainly studies the key communication techniques in AIS, such as STDMA protocol, net synchronization and GMSK(Gaussian Minimum Shift Keying)technique, and so on. At last this paper briefly introduces the recommendation decided by IMO on forcing the sea-going ships to fixed with AIS equipments, and it continuos with the unexploited potential of AIS if it applies in VTS.

  • Based upon the research and analysis on the downtown residents' satisfaction with their current housing areas and preference for future housing areas, this study clarifies the following. First, the breakdown on various factors influencing the housing environment indicates that downtown residents are the most satisfied with the easy access to the public transportation, and cultural and commercial facilities. Second, they are not content with the amenity aspects such as the air, noise, and the surrounding views, and the economic aspects such as the prices of the houses and the prospects for future investment. The low satisfaction suggests that the amenity aspects and economic aspects should be considered for future downtown housing development. Third, more than half of the residents in downtown areas still prefer to dwell in downtown areas. In the future downtown development, the close analysis on the characteristics of downtown dwelling, and the researches on the right direction of downtown housing development for the whole citizens of Daegu should be done in advance. Last, the majority of people wishing to reside in downtown want medium- or large-scale apartment complexes. In the future downtown housing development, it should be focused on the downtown residence with complex functions rather than on the small-scale maintenance projects.

  • The purpose of this study is to identify the planning features of apartments that are people-friendly, nature-friendly and ones that improve the quality of the apartments through sustainable design characteristics found in the apartment community space. This study found the sustainable design characteristics through the case of 8 environment-friendly apartment in the Seoul-Gyeunggi area. Sustainable design was categorized into three areas a) social sustainability b) economic sustainability c) ecological sustainability. The major findings are summarized as follows: First, socially sustainable design which included plans for various types of squares, spaces for pedestrians showed high application of universal design plans. While, plans to maximize open spaces that facilitate the social exchanges among residents showed low application. Second, economically sustainable design showed high application in terms of access to public transportation and bicycle storage facilities. However, planning factors such as alternative energy facilities, recyclable materials, reuse of rainwaterand heavy water showed low application. Third, environmentally sustainable design included high application of promenades, artificially created green space and various types of water space. On the other hand, nature study centers, biotope and environment friendly parking space showed low application.

  • In Seoul, several railway depots are located at the places where a public can easily access. Since a depot occupy a large amount of land itself, it is natural to use those sites for a public building construction such as an apartment complex or a transportation terminal, as an example. Most of the buildings on a depot, however, are exposed to vibration problems, because foundations are excited from the dynamic loading whenever heavy trains pass on the track. Severe vibration may cause a damage to building structures and a troublesome to a community. In this paper, some vibration practices have been examined in order to resolve the vibration problems. First, a critical speed of a train in a railway depot is evaluated. Then, a structural effect on the transmission of a vibration energy has been investigated. Finally, practical approaches to reduce the vibration level have been proposed. In this first half part of the paper, the focus has been on the critical speed and a structural transmission phenomena.

  • The purpose of this paper is to shed the light on one of the most important influential factors for the development the Palestinian economy, which is logistics system. The discussion about the Palestinian state and its economy arise after the UN General Assembly voted to grant Palestine a nonmember state. Palestine is considered land-locked country, although it has seashore. Although Palestine has seashore, it is considered land-locked country due to the lack of sovereign logistics infrastructure. International Trade with Israel, Jordan, and Egypt is done through land border crossings. Palestinian international trade to European, Asian, and American countries is currently done through Israeli airports and seaports. Almost 99% of the Palestinian imports are through land. Israeli policies and procedures incur Palestinian exports additional transportation costs when delivering their products to Israeli ports and Airport and even when transit these cargos to neighboring countries through Israeli controlled areas. Therefore, without direct access to international markets, the Palestinian economy will not be able to compete in international markets, and will continue its dependence on the Israeli economy. Considering that the current situation will continue, alternative routes for international trade to avoid using the Israeli ports are Aqaba Port in Jordan and Port Said in Egypt. In the long term, having a seaport and Airport in Gaza, Airport in the West Bank, and constructing the Corridor connecting Gaza and the West Bank, is the only solution capable for independently integrating the Palestinian economy with the region and other countries in the world, and therefore creating competitive advantage for the Palestinian exports.
